### sec.21C Magistrate may make device inspection order for reportable offender
This section applies if, in relation to a reportable offender, the circumstances mentioned in section 21B (1) (a) and (b) do not apply.
A police officer may apply to a magistrate for an order (a device inspection order ) authorising a police officer, on a stated day or on 1 day during a stated period, to inspect any digital devices in the possession of a reportable offender.
The magistrate may make the device inspection order if satisfied there is an elevated risk that the reportable offender will engage in conduct that may constitute a reportable offence against, or in relation to, a child or children.
In this section—
digital device see the Child Protection (Offender Reporting and Offender Prohibition Order) Act 2004 , schedule 5 .
reportable offence see the Child Protection (Offender Reporting and Offender Prohibition Order) Act 2004 , schedule 5 .
s 21C ins 2023 No. 21 s 50
